The King Is Like Other Mortals

I also am mortal like everyone else,
a descendant of the first-formed child of earth,
and in the womb of a mother I was molded into flesh,(A)
within the period of ten months, compacted with blood,
from the seed of a man and the pleasure of marriage.
And when I was born, I began to breathe the common air
and fell upon the kindred earth;
my first sound was a cry, as is true of all.(B)
I was nursed with care in swaddling cloths.(C)
For no king has had a different beginning of existence;
there is for all one entrance into life and one way out.(D)
